Return of a Predator - the big bad wolf is back

January 17, 2013

Wolves were once considered extinct in Germany. But they're back. More than 100 wolves are now living in the country, most of them in the state of Brandenburg. Wolves are predators, and prey on wild animals, as well as sheep and goats. The Brandenburg government has already reacted, with wolf consultants and a wolf management program.
